How much does foundation repair typically cost in Davenport?
The cost of foundation repair in Davenport varies depending on the extent of damage, the type of foundation, and the repair method needed. On average, homeowners might expect costs ranging from a few thousand to over ten thousand dollars. We recommend getting a professional inspection to provide an accurate quote for your specific situation.
Does homeowners insurance cover foundation repair in Davenport?
Homeowners insurance policies in Davenport generally do not cover foundation repair if the damage is due to normal settling, wear and tear, or poor maintenance. However, if the damage is caused by a covered peril like a sudden plumbing leak or a natural disaster, your policy may provide coverage. It's best to review your policy and speak with your insurance provider for details.

Can I live in my house during foundation repair in Davenport?
In many cases, you can live in your home during foundation repair in Davenport, especially if the work is on the exterior or in crawl spaces. However, for extensive repairs that involve significant structural work or safety risks, it may be necessary to temporarily relocate. Your contractor will advise you based on the specifics of your project.
